A community built on understanding
QMHNI was founded by members of the LGBTQIA+ community in Northern Ireland who recognised the urgent need for dedicated mental health support. We understand the unique pressures of navigating identity, community, and wellbeing in our region.
From our service directory to our community forum, every part of this platform is designed to help you find the support you deserve - on your terms, in your time.

About me
Who am I?
Drawing upon years of experience of living with a Severe Mental Health Illness, working with several mental health charities helping to reduce shame and stigma around Mental Health, especially within the Queer Community, where it is needed most at the minute. Advocating for those with ill mental health, and working with other organisations to bring positive changes within Local Councils and Stormont. Involved in a couple long term research projects within the Ulster University to hopefully reduce barriers for those with ill mental health to get back into Further Education, and also to create a steering group of experts by experience to speak up as the voices of those people in City Councils and Stormont etc. I am also in my 3 year of a Psychology Degree.
